Achieving a successful research paper depends on the researcher’s skills and ability to choose a subject, formulate a topic, focus on a meaningful thesis, thoroughly investigate the subject, analyze the information and report the results.

Research paper writing takes the following broad sequential procedures;
• Pre-writing: Decide on the subject and topic you are conversant with. Narrow down your topic to specific ideas. Consider your reader’s needs, interests and level of understanding of your subject. Gather the necessary information.
• Planning: Decide on the preliminary thesis to choose, structure and organization.
• Drafting: Write your ideas, discover and include new ones. Do not bother of paragraphing, sentences, grammar, spellings or punctuations.
• Revising: Emphasize the accuracy and relevancy of your content, ensuring proper structure and organization.
• Finishing: Cater for grammar, mechanics and proofreading to achieve a final copy.

Good Research Topics are not that Difficult to Find

Good research topics form the backbone of a good thesis paper. So it is essential that a student takes great care while hunting for a topic for his research paper writing. It would be a good idea to choose a topic from the writer’s field of interest. The topics for the paper may vary according to the subject of the course or according to what the teacher sets as a topic. Some topics may be easy to write on with lots of ready material available while others may involve a great deal of research work by the student. Often the teacher allows the student to choose their own topic which is always the better option. This allows for the student to choose  a topic of his own personal interest. While choosing a topic the student has to keep in mind the availability of supporting material for the theme. It is useless to write a paper on a topic on which no ready data is available. It is also important to remember that too much of available data may pose to be a problem with the student wondering which material to sieve out and which one to keep. Too much information will also make the research paper unnecessarily long and tedious. So a student should choose a research topic which is appealing but not too commonplace. These are a few points to be remembered while choosing a topic. The topic must be interesting to the student and something the student is familiar with, it must have the required amount of available data for research work, and it must be fairly important and interesting too with facts that will impart knowledge to the reader.

Controversial Research Topics – Choose the Correct One and do a Thorough Research Work on it

Controversial Research Topics. The name itself suggests what to look for. There are however many controversial topics to write on and it is easy to lose oneself in the maze. The best way to start is to do some hunting around. Newspapers, articles, journals, online libraries, search engines etc make the best hunting ground. A list of controversial topics is to be fished out, of which the one that the writer finds closest to his heart is to be finalized. The background of the issue is to be thoroughly researched and all sorts of data, facts and figures are to be noted down to used in the research paper. The best would be to choose some relevant, current controversial topic and work on it. All past and current data are to be dug out and presented in the writing. The writing will necessarily contain the writer’ views and thoughts. Only the “expert” opinions will not do. All arguments and opinions that the writer wishes to present in the paper are to be backed up by solid evidences. He may present his research paper in the form of a critical essay, an argumentative essay or may be even a persuasive essay. Whatever type the essay may be, the format should be correct without any spelling and grammatical errors. The most important aspect would be how well-researched the paper is and how well the writer understood the topic. While writing one has to keep an unbiased, open mind and be rational about the issue and not get carried away emotionally.
